When you hire an accident lawyer, fees usually depend on the complexity of your case. Factors that move the needle include the severity of your injuries, the amount of property damage, and how clearly the other driver is at fault. Cases involving multiple vehicles or disputed police reports often require more investigation, which can impact the final agreement. Most attorneys work on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than an upfront fee. While contingency rates typically range from 33% to 40% depending on whether a trial is necessary, ex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

Key evidence in truck accident cases includes the police report, accident scene photos, witness statements, and the truck driver's logbooks and company records. Any data from the truck's "black box" or dashcam footage can also be extremely important. The pros can help gather this critical information.

Avoid admitting fault, discussing settlement amounts, or providing speculative information about the accident to anyone other than your lawyer. Stick to the factual details of what occurred and your injuries. Be completely honest and thorough with your chosen legal professional. They are there to guide you.
